PM Modi Inaugurates 3rd global renewable energy event RE-INVEST  2020
Prime Minister Narendra Modi inaugurated the 3rd Global Renewable Energy Investment Meeting and Expo (RE-INVEST 2020) to woo investors for investing in clean energy in India.India has set an ambitious target of having 175GW of renewable energy by 2022 and 450GW by 2030.

  • The summit is organised by the Ministry of New and Renewable Energy.The theme for RE-Invest 2020 is ‘Innovations for Sustainable Energy Transition’. 
  • The RE-INVEST 2020 include a two-day virtual conference on renewables and future energy choices and an exhibition of manufacturers, developers, investors and innovators engaged in the clean energy sector.
  • The partner countries for the RE-INVEST 2020 are Australia, Denmark, France, Germany, Maldives, the United Kingdom along with European Union and US agencies.The partner states are Gujarat, Himachal Pradesh, Madhya Pradesh, Rajasthan and Tamil Nadu.

Agriculture Minister unveils ‘Sahakar Pragya’ to impart training to primary cooperative societies in rural areas
Agriculture Minister Narendra Singh Tomar unveiled Sahakar Pragya. The 45 new training modules of Sahakar Pragya of the National Cooperative Development Corporation (NCDC) will impart training to primary cooperative societies in rural areas of the country along with Lakshmanrao Inamdar National Cooperative Research and Development Academy.

  • These 45 training modules pf Sahakar Pragya to be delivered at LINAC and its countrywide network of Regional Training Centres will address the need for training of Primary cooperatives, FPO-Cooperatives and Self Help Groups federating.
  • The training programmes will be supported under NCDC schemes, 10,000 FPO formation scheme of Government of India, Agri Infra Fund scheme of Government of India , PM-FME scheme of Min of Food Processing Industry, Dairy Infra Dev Fund scheme of Government of India, Fisheries Infra Dev Fund scheme of Government of India, PM MatsyaSampada Yojana of Government of India, Min of Rural Dev schemes State/UT schemes Other organizations’ schemes.

Quarantine’ named Cambridge Dictionary’s Word of the Year 2020
Cambridge Dictionary has named ‘quarantine’ as the Word of the Year 2020,the year that saw people around the world being forced to remain isolated indoors in the midst of the coronavirus pandemic.

  • ‘Lockdown’ and ‘pandemic’ turned out to be runner-ups for Word of the Year.
  • ‘Quarantine’ was the only word that ranked among the top five in both overall views and search spikes in 2020.

UN release $25 mn for women-led projects fighting gender-based violence
The United Nations humanitarian chief has released 25 million US dollars from its emergency fund to support women-led organisations that prevent and respond to gender-based violence.

  • The funding has gone to the United Nations Population Fund (UNFPA) and UN Women that have been asked to channel at least 30 per cent of it to organisations run by women that prevent violence against women and girls, and help victims and survivors with access to medical care, family planning, legal advice, safe spaces, mental health services and counselling.

ESIC extends ABVKY scheme up to June 2021
ESI Corporation (ESIC) has announced the extension of the “Atal Beemit Vyakti Kalyan Yojana” (ABVKY) by another one year up to June 30, 2021 and relaxed the eligibility conditions for the period between March 24, 2020 and December 31, 2020.

  • It has also been decided to enhance the rate of unemployment relief under the scheme to 50% of wages from earlier rate of 25% along with relaxation in eligibility conditions, provided the Insured Person should have been in insurable employment for a minimum period of two years immediately before her/his unemployment and should have contributed for not less than 78 days in the contribution period immediately preceding to unemployment and minimum 78 days in one of the remaining three contribution periods in two years prior to unemployment.

Sports Ministry restores recognition of Archery Association of India
Youth Affairs and Sports Ministry has restored the government recognition to Archery Association of India as a Nation Sports Federation for promotion and regulation of Archery Sport in the country.

  • Government recognition of AAI was withdrawn eight years back on account of failure to conduct its elections in accordance with the National Sports Development Code of India. Government recognition of AAI will be valid for one year.

Shri Thaawarchand Gehlot e-launches ‘National Portal for Transgender Persons’
The Social Justice and Empowerment Ministry launched a National portal for transgender persons to apply for certificates and identity cards.

  • The portal had been developed within two months of the Ministry notifying the Transgender Persons (Protection of Rights) Rules, 2020, on September 29.
  • The portal would help transpersons in applying for certificate and ID cards digitally without having to visit any government office.
  • The portal transgender.dosje.gov.in would enable the applicant to track their application and register their grievances in case of delays.

23 medicinal plants of Karnataka on international union’s endangered list
At a time when climate change and infrastructural projects are wreaking havoc on forests, an exhaustive study commissioned by the Karnataka Biodiversity Board and National Medicinal Plants Board (NMPB) has revealed that 23 rare medicinal plants in various forests of the state are on the verge of extinction and listed as ‘endangered’ on the International Union for Conservation of Nature (IUCN) list.

  • The red-listed rare medicinal plants include sandalwood, wild clove, red sanders, wild jamun, wild cinnamon and other species endemic to the Western Ghats.
  • The study spanning five years by forest officials, botanists and field experts helped document more than 4,800 flowering plant species in various circles of the forests. Out of these, 60 rare species are medically prominent, including the 23 endangered species.

AIMPLB vice president Maulana Kalbe Sadiq passes away
Well-known Shia cleric Maulana Kalbe Sadiq died in Lucknow. He was 83.

  • Sadiq was an educationist, Islamic scholar and ambassador of communal amity. He was the first to organise a Shia-Sunni namaz in the history of Lucknow.
  • He was also All India Muslim Personal Law Board vice president.

Indian Constitution Day
Constitution Day or Samvidhan Diwas is celebrated annually in India on 26 November to promote Constitution values among citizens. The day is also known as National Law Day.

  • The day commemorates the adoption of the Constitution in On this day in 1949, the Constituent Assembly of India formally adopted the Constitution of India that came into force on 26 January 1950.

National Milk Day
The National Milk Day is celebrated every year on November 26 in India to honour Dr. Verghese Kurien, who is considered to be the father of India’s White Revolution.

  • The day marks his birth anniversary and is a tribute for his contribution in the dairy world.
